Muscle Proximal attachment(s) Distal attachment(s) Primary action(s)
Posteromedial muscles (continued)
Flexor digitorum longus
(FLEK-sor di-ji-TOR-um LON-gus)
Posterior surface of tibia
and tibialis posterior
fascia
Bases of distal phalanges
of toes 2-4; each tendon
passes through opening in
corresponding tendon of
flexor digitorum brevis
Flexion of lesser toes
A-F plantar flexion
Foot inversion
Lateral muscles
Peroneus longus
(per-o-NEE-us LON-gus)
Lateral tibial condyle
Lateral aspect of upper
two-thirds of fibula
Lateral aspect of first
cuneiform
Proximal first metatarsal
Foot eversion
A-F plantar flexion
Depresses head of
first metatarsal
Peroneus brevis
(per-o-NEE-us BRE-vis)
Lateral aspect of lower
two-thirds of fibula
Tuberosity at proximal end
of fifth metatarsal
Foot eversion
A-F plantar flexion
